Coordinate planes can help you solve problems with polygons, such as rectangles.

If points A (5, 2), B (5, -7), and C (-5, -7) are vertices of a rectangle, where does vertex D fall?
Connect the vertices and then draw lines straight from points A and C to find where vertex D will fall.
Point D occurs at point (-5, 2).

Use the coordinate grids to find the missing vertex of each polygon.

Question 1.
a rectangle with points at (0, 2), (-6, 2), and (-6, 4)
The missing point is at ______.

Answer:
Let us assume the given points (0, 2), (-6, 2) and (-6, 4) as A,B and C respectively.
Connect the vertices A,B,C and then draw lines straight from points A and C.
The intersecting point of both will be the point D.
Thus, point D will be (0,4)

Question 2.
a rectangle with points at (3, -4), (3, 5), and (-2, 5)
The missing point is at _____

Answer:
Let us assume the given points(3, -4), (3, 5), and (-2, 5) as A,B and C respectively.
Connect the vertices A,B,C and then draw lines straight from points A and C.
The intersecting point of both will be the point D.
Thus, point D will be (-2,-4)
